When you arrive at Taffs Well, you'll notice the station is straightforward, yet it covers the basics. While there isn't a ticket office on site, there are ticket machines where you can collect tickets purchased online or pay by card. Unfortunately, these machines do not accept cash, so ensure you have your card handy. The station is equipped with an induction loop for those who may need it, and customer information is readily available with departure and arrival screens, as well as announcement facilities.
Accessibility is partially accommodated with step-free access to both platforms. However, moving between platforms requires using a footbridge with steps, so plan accordingly if accessibility is a concern. Additionally, while there aren't waiting rooms or accessible toilets, a seating area is available for your convenience.
The station boasts a free 24-hour car park with 88 spaces, although it should be noted that there are no dedicated accessible spaces or CCTV for added security. While the station lacks refreshment facilities and an ATM, the convenience of Taffs Well's location allows for quick detours to nearby local cafes and shops if needed.

Marden station is equipped with key amenities to ensure a smooth and efficient travel experience. For purchasing and collecting tickets, there is a ticket office open during morning hours throughout the week and a ticket machine that allows for the collection of tickets bought online. For those with accessibility needs, the station offers step-free access to Platform 1 for London-bound services. Although Platform 2 doesn't provide the same ease of access, staff is on hand to assist during operating hours if needed. Additionally, the station has induction loops for the hearing impaired and accessible ticket machines conveniently located by entrance to Platform 1.
Travelers looking to relax before their departure will find seating areas available, although there are no waiting rooms or lounge facilities. While Marden lacks some typical amenities like toilets or baby changing facilities, it does have a coffee kiosk and a small kiosk selling newspapers to keep you refreshed and entertained during your wait. CCTV is in operation throughout the facility for added security, and free assistance can be arranged for those needing help with their travels.
